Safeguarding the Homes of Singaporeans with the
Structural Health Monitoring (SHM) system
An Open and Generic Structural Health Monitoring (SHM) system which can automatically capture, wirelessly transmit and analyse and visualise structural condition is crucial for critical infrastructures such as high-rise building, tunnels and transportation assets, to ensure their safety and increase maintenance productivity.
Universal Interrogator:
To achieve reliable and effective health monitoring, a single SHM project may include different types and brands of fiber optic sensors. Currently, these sensors often require different demodulation techniques and interrogators, which complicates and costs the project and limits the large-scale deployment of SHM. Our developed universal interrogator leverages existing components, particularly mass-produced optical communication components, to provide a software-definable sensor interface for demodulating these different types and brands of fiber optic sensors while achieving low cost and high reliability.
Benefit:
- Ability to interrogate multiple different fiber optic sensors (software definable for each port)
- High accuracy and resolution (comparable with existing products)
- Scalable (port number)
- Cost and power efficient
